EMT Class Exam I 100% Pass What are the four levels of EMS training? ✔✔1) Emergency Medical Responder (EMR) 2) Emergency Medical Technician (EMT) 3) Advanced Emergency Medical Technician (AEMT)... 4) Paramedic What does the EMR do? (3, a-d) ✔✔1) First one at the scene. 2) Police officers, firefighters, and industrial health personnel may function in this position. 3) Emphasis on (a) activating EMS system and (b) providing immediate care for life threatening injuries, (c) controlling the scene, and (d) preparing for the arrival of the ambulance. What does the EMT do? (2) ✔✔1) Minimum level for ambulance personnel. 2) Provide basic-level medical and trauma care and transportation to a medical facility. What does the AEMT do? (1, 2:a-c) ✔✔1) Basic-level care and transportation. 2) Advanced-level care including: (a) advanced airway devices, (b) monitoring of blood glucose levels, and (c) administration of some medications (both intravenous and intraosseous. What does a paramedic do? ✔✔The paramedic performs all of the skills of an EMT and AEMT in addition to more advanced level skills. The paramedic provides the most advanced level of prehospital care. What are BSI procedures? ✔✔Body substance isolation procedures (also known as Standard Precautions) that protect you from the blood and body fluids of the patient and vice versa. What should be worn whenever there is potential for contact with blood and other body fluids? ✔✔Protective gloves. What actions warrant use of protective gloves? ✔✔Controlling bleeding, suctioning, artificial ventilation, and CPR. Why should eye protection be worn? ✔✔The mucous membranes surrounding the eyes are capable of absorbing fluids that have splashed, spattered, or sprayed from the patient. In cases where there will be blood or fluid splatter, what should be worn? ✔✔Surgical-type mask. In cases where the patient is suspected to have tuberculosis, what should be worn? ✔✔An N-95 mask or a HEPA respirator. What should be worn to protect clothing and bare skin from spilled or splashed fluids? ✔✔Gown What situations call for the use of a gown? (3) ✔✔Arterial spurting (bleeding.) Childbirth. Patients with multiple injuries (have the potential to produce lots of blood.)
